University Daily Kansan Wednesday, December 9, 1970 11 Art Museum To Present Early Music The event is an informal Christmas program of early music to be performed by the KU band under direction of J. Bunker Clark, associate professor music history, p.m. Friday in the room 5 in the University Library. "Drop by after your classes, have a cup of holiday punch, listen as long as you like and face fina with a little heart." So reads the invitation extended to KU students and faculty by the Museum of Art. The program, co-sponsored by the Museum of Art and the School of Music, will be held medieval trombone-like instruments; recorders, gambas, trumpets, tuba, harparschop. Both vocal and instrumental selections will be presented.
